What are the strategies of roof inspection
Roof inspections are important for identifying potential issues and making certain the longevity of your roof. Regular inspections might help detect issues early, stopping expensive repairs or replacements down the road. Here are some frequent methods and steps for conducting a roof inspection:
Visual Inspection:
a. Exterior Inspection:
Start by examining the roof from the bottom utilizing binoculars or by safely climbing onto a ladder to get a better look.
Look for seen indicators of damage, corresponding to missing or damaged shingles, curling or buckling shingles, or free or deteriorated flashing around roof penetrations.
Check for debris, moss, algae, or lichen development on the roof, which may point out moisture-related points.
Inspect the gutters and downspouts for granules from shingles, as extreme granule loss can signal shingle put on.
b. Interior Inspection:
Go into the attic or crawl house and examine the underside of the roof deck for indicators of leaks, moisture, or water stains.
Look for daylight coming via cracks or holes in the roof deck, which can indicate roof damage.
Check for signs of insulation injury, mould, or mildew development, which may end result from roof leaks.
Roof Walk:
a. If it's secure to take action, walk on the roof surface to examine it up close.
b. Be cautious and wear acceptable safety gear, similar to non-slip sneakers and a security harness if needed.
c. Look for any delicate or spongy areas, which could point out underlying injury.
d. Check for free or damaged roofing supplies, as nicely as indicators of damage and tear.
Moisture Detection:
a. Use a moisture meter to detect hidden moisture within the roof construction and insulation.
b. Moisture detection may help determine leaks or areas of potential water intrusion that is most likely not visible.
Drone Inspection:
a. Drones geared up with cameras can provide a complete view of the roof floor with out the need for direct physical access.
b. A drone inspection can be particularly helpful for bigger or hard-to-reach roofs.

Documentation:
a. Document your findings with photographs and notes to create a report of the roof's condition.
b. This documentation may be helpful for monitoring modifications over time and for insurance claims or repairs.
It's essential to perform roof inspections regularly, ideally at least every year, and after severe weather events like storms.
